Your new company
Huge global company, with a HQ based near the Sydney CBD with fantastic ethos, is environmentally conscious and offers professional development and further opportunities at this busy time. They have a large number of sites and offices across Australia and New Zealand (and more around the world).
Your new role
- You will work in partnership with the business to develop solutions and provide high level service consistent with the Australia and New Zealand (ANZ) policy, strategy and the business units needs.
- Provide input to projects, business plans and helps integrate People policies and initiatives into the business.
- Identify activities within HR that are not aligned with organisational goals and raises appropriate challenges.
- Use HR data & information diagnostic skills, business acumen and customer relationships to identify, articulate and deliver value propositions and/or judgement to make well balanced strategic decisions.
- Works with the business to develop organisational workforce plans to meet current and future needs.
- A large portion of the assignment will involve:
Dispute resolution,
Performance management and plans,
Assisting with EA Negotiations,
Travel across Sydney and NSW for site visits,
Occasional inter-state travel (infrequent)
What you'll need to succeed
- You will have knowledge, and be comfortable assisting in EA Negotiations and agreements (with support from Senior BPs).
- You will have at least a Bachelor's Degree in Business (Human Resources) or equivalent/relevant qualification, or an HR specific certification (e.g. Cert IV in HR Management).
- Minimum 5 years' experience in a generalist HR role with proven experience in ER, IR.
- Experience in the interpretation and application of relevant ANZ legislation and regulations.
- You will be strong using MS Office or Google Suite - such as Excel, Word, Powerpoint etc.
- Ideally you will have experience in SuccessFactors.
